Newstalkzb.com reports that Channing Tatum is behind a new sitcom NICKY for Warner Bros. TV. The actor will executive produce the half-hour comedy along with Reid Carolin and actor Nick Zano, who will also star in the series.

Channing announced on his Facebook page, "We've spent many nights laughing our asses off with our pal Nick Zano and his tales of being raised in a multi-generational house of seven women in New Jersey. And now we're so proud to announce that we're bringing those stories to your home! Look out for NICKY, a new sitcom from Warner Bros. TV, starring Nick and produced by us, next year!"

According to Deadline, "Nick will play 30-year old Nicky, who is trying to finally move out of the house only to realize he needs to stay and help raise his youngest sister."

Channing and Reid have previously worked together on the sequels to '21 Jump Street' and 'Magic Mike' as well as an upcoming Evel Knievel biopic in which Channing will play the canyon-leaping daredevil.
